Entitete besedila v entitete HTML se nanaša na pretvorbo posebnih znakov v besedilnem nizu (kot so <, >, &, " itd.) v ustrezne kode entitet HTML. Entitete HTML se uporabljajo za predstavitev znakov, ki imajo v HTML poseben pomen, kot so < za manj kot (<), > za večje kot (>) in & za ampersand (&). Te entitete omogočajo varno vključitev posebnih znakov v dokumente HTML, ne da bi pri tem motile strukturo HTML.
Entitete besedila v entitete HTML bi uporabili iz več razlogov:
Preprečite vbrizgavanje HTML ali napade XSS: S pretvorbo posebnih znakov v entitete HTML zagotovite, da se vsak uporabniški vnos, ki vsebuje znake, kot sta < ali >, obravnava kot besedilo in ne kot HTML ali skripta.
Pravilen prikaz posebnih znakov: Nekateri znaki, kot so &, <, > ali ", imajo v HTML-ju poseben pomen, njihova pretvorba v entitete HTML pa zagotavlja, da so pravilno prikazani v brskalnikih.
Ubežni znaki v kodi: Pri vdelavi uporabniško ustvarjene vsebine ali dinamične vsebine v HTML pretvorba besedila v entitete HTML zagotavlja, da znaki ne motijo oznak ali atributov HTML.
Zagotovite združljivost med brskalniki in sistemi: Uporaba entitet HTML zagotavlja, da se znaki dosledno upodabljajo na različnih platformah, tudi če kodiranje ni pravilno nastavljeno ali ko se vsebina prenaša med sistemi.
Če želite uporabiti Entitete BESEDILA v HTML:
Kopirajte besedilo, ki vsebuje posebne znake (kot so <, >, &, " itd.).
Prilepite besedilo v spletni pretvornik
Zaženite pretvorbo in orodje bo posebne znake zamenjalo z ustreznimi kodami entitet HTML.
Kopirajte pretvorjeno besedilo, ki zdaj vsebuje entitete, varne za HTML, in ga uporabite v dokumentu HTML, pri čemer se prepričajte, da se pravilno prikaže.
Uporabite BESEDILO v entitete HTML, kadar:
Prikazovanje vsebine, ki jo ustvarijo uporabniki: Če uporabniki oddajo besedilo (npr. komentarje, ocene ali vnos obrazca), pretvorba v entitete HTML zagotavlja, da posebni znaki ne porušijo strukture HTML ali ne povzročijo varnostnih tveganj (npr. medspletno skriptanje ali XSS).
Obravnavanje posebnih znakov v URL-jih: Entitete HTML se pogosto uporabljajo v parametrih URL-jev, da se zagotovi, da znaki, kot sta & in =, ne motijo razčlenjevanja nizov poizvedb.
Ustvarjanje e-poštnih sporočil HTML ali dokumentov s posebnimi znaki, ki morajo biti pravilno prikazani v različnih e-poštnih odjemalcih in brskalnikih.
Vdelava besedila v dokumente HTML, kjer morajo biti znaki, kot so <, >, &, " in ', varno predstavljeni, da se izognemo konfliktom z oznakami ali atributi HTML.
Delo z večjezično vsebino: Posebne znake iz različnih jezikov (npr. naglasi, diakritiki) je morda treba pretvoriti v entitete HTML, da se zagotovi doslednost upodabljanje.